What Somnia Is
EVM-compatible Layer 1: If you know Ethereum, you’re already at home. Solidity, MetaMask, Hardhat, and Foundry all work seamlessly.
Blazing speed: Somnia claims over 1,000,000 transactions per second, with near-instant finality and pennies in fees. Perfect for apps where every millisecond counts.
Built for people, not just DeFi: Somnia is designed for apps where users interact every second, from games to social worlds to the metaverse.
Backed by experts: Core tech supported by Improbable and MSquared, combining blockchain with next-level simulation expertise.
Token SOMI: 1 billion tokens for gas, staking, and future governance.
Regulatory transparency: A MiCA white paper filed in the EU details token utility, supply, and planned trading paths.

How It Works, Simply
Somnia’s tech is ambitious but approachable. It’s built to deliver speed without compromising safety.
MultiStream Consensus
Every validator maintains its own “data stream”
A separate chain orders all streams using a modified proof-of-stake design
Result: consensus and data production happen independently, unlocking massive throughput
Accelerated Sequential Execution
EVM code runs fast and efficiently, avoiding pitfalls of parallel EVM execution
IceDB (State Database)
Custom-built for predictable, fast performance
Reads and writes return real-time performance metrics, making gas fees fair and transparent
Snapshotting reduces heavy computation
Advanced Compression & Signature Aggregation
Optimizes network bandwidth at massive scale
Aggregates multiple signatures into small packages, keeping the network smooth
Ensures that validators only upload what’s necessary
Security & Decentralization
Proof-of-Stake with slashing ensures validators act honestly
~100 global validators at launch for a balance of speed and decentralization
Independent client, “Cuthbert”, runs parallel checks to catch bugs before they hit users
Gas Model & Fees
Paid in SOMI, Ethereum-style but optimized for high-speed apps
Volume discounts save high-TPS apps up to 90% on gas
Transient storage for short-lived game state is cheaper
Gas fees split: 50% to validators, 50% burned, adding deflationary pressure
Tokenomics
Total supply: 1 billion SOMI
Uses: staking, gas, future governance
Unlocks over ~48 months, with staggered releases for team, investors, partners, and community
Public unlock charts available for full transparency

Pros and Cons
Pros
Ultra-fast and low-latency, perfect for real-time apps
Easy for Ethereum developers to port existing projects
Smart pipelines reduce network congestion
IceDB ensures gas is fair and predictable
Volume discounts and transient storage fit entertainment workloads
Growing ecosystem support for tools, custody, and validators
Cons
New chain risks; tech and operations are still young
~100 validators may feel less decentralized to some
EVM speedups need real-world stress testing
Ecosystem and user base still growing
Key Risks
Tech: MultiStream, IceDB, and compression are complex; bugs are possible
Decentralization: Higher hardware needs and fewer validators may raise concerns
Economics: Long unlock schedules could create supply pressures
Regulatory: MiCA filing isn’t approval; rules could change
Adoption: Apps must succeed to unlock Somnia’s potential
